I have seen that before. I run my own Hue Bridge Emulator within a docker and I believe the issue was narrowed down to having multiple generations of Echo devices on my network. This would cause my $device to appear multiple times within the Alexa app. Amazon had a sale on echo dots, and also gave trade in credits, so I was able to take advantage of that and upgrade my Gen 1 and Gen 2 dots to Gen 3 at about $10 each. Once all my generations were the same, I cleaned up the known devices and initiated a discovery again. Every once in a while I get something similar to below, but it doesn't happen very often.
